Output 77b26798429e15e47a9ecddf3c2b115d4753afc5721cb9d980c1639b33e3f2e6:5

value
594655
script pubkey
OP_0 OP_PUSHBYTES_20 ce1e219daf6aefd8d4fe51e5e411b701731ac36a
address
bc1qec0zr8d0dtha348728j7gydhq9e34sm2ezdukr
transaction
77b26798429e15e47a9ecddf3c2b115d4753afc5721cb9d980c1639b33e3f2e6
spent
true